UPPER MARLBORO, Md. (CBSDC) - The Prince George’s County Fair in Upper Marlboro opens to the public Thursday evening and will run throughout the weekend.
The annual event runs from Thurs., Sept. 6 through Sun., Sept. 9 and is located at the Prince George’s Equestrian Center and Show Place Arena at 14900 Pennsylvania Avenue in Upper Marlboro, near the intersection of Route 4 and Route 301. Tickets are free for children ages five and under and cost $6 for ages twelve and up. Gates open at 4 p.m. on Thursday and 11 a.m. on Saturday and Sunday.
Visitors can expect attractions available for all ages, ranging from magic shows to dance exhibitions, to pig and duck races. They can see work from chainsaw artists and balloon artists as well.
